Why Do ATV Accidents Happen in Carroll County?

While off-roading is popular, ATV accidents often result from a mix of human error and environmental hazards. In Carroll, IL, common causes include:

  • Rollovers on uneven or hilly terrain
  • Speeding or reckless riding, particularly by youth riders
  • Failure to use helmets or safety gear
  • Alcohol or drug use while operating the vehicle
  • Equipment failure, such as defective brakes or steering
  • Inadequate signage or maintenance on private trails

Who Can Be Held Liable for an ATV Crash in carroll-il?

Under Illinois law, several parties may be liable for your injuries, depending on where and how the accident occurred:

  • The ATV operator, if their behavior was careless or reckless
  • Property owners, for unsafe conditions or failure to post warnings
  • Manufacturers, in cases involving defective ATVs or components
  • Rental companies, for failing to maintain the vehicle or provide instructions

What Compensation Can You Recover?

Victims of ATV accidents in Carroll County may be entitled to damages for:

  • Medical expenses, including surgery, hospital care, rehabilitation, and long-term treatment
  • Lost wages and reduced ability to earn in the future
  • Pain and suffering, including emotional distress and trauma
  • Property damage to your ATV or personal belongings
  • Permanent disability or disfigurement
  • Loss of enjoyment of life, for long-term lifestyle changes

Statute of Limitations — File Your Claim On Time

According to 735 ILCS 5/13-202, you have two years from the date of the ATV accident to file a personal injury lawsuit. Waiting too long can result in the loss of your legal rights.

Frequently Asked Questions — ATV Accidents in carroll-il

What if I weren’t wearing a helmet?

You can still file a claim. Not wearing a helmet may reduce your damages under comparative fault, but it doesn’t prevent you from seeking compensation.

Who can I sue for an ATV crash on private property?

Property owners may be liable if their land has hidden dangers or if they allow unsafe use.

Can I sue if a defective ATV part caused the crash?

Yes. You may have a product liability claim against the manufacturer or seller.

Can I file on behalf of a child injured on an ATV?

Yes. Illinois allows guardians to bring injury claims on behalf of minors.
